Last year was the first winter with my C28. As with my previous boat, I winterized and left it in the water. I also added bilge and cabin heater for extra piece of mind (something I never did with the previous boat), and temperature sensors for remote monitoring. My current marina doesn't do bubblers so I also purchased a Kasco once I realized we were in for an unusual freeze. Good thing, because we definitely ended up getting a lot of ice and I stayed basically ice free in my slip. All in all, everything went well...
... except for my stress levels about everything. As a result, I'm debating hauling and storing on land this year. I'm not sure I love the downside of not having the extra piece of mind with the heaters and sensors, but I like the upside of not having to worry about it freezing and sinking. That and I can touch up anything that needs done before spring. I think I was spoiled by my old marina and how they basically took care of everything for me! I never worried then... although it sure cost me $$$! :lol:
Anyway, for those of you that haul and block, what sort of set up do you have? Blocks, stands, etc. I'm trying to get a plan of what I need put together in case I decide to haul.
